Output ec607b5bd668f98fd47981c84cfa9f954e67f9825d752a2e5fd4f7c82b053296:98

value
96561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a2b4c4b09f5b56ceee90cca329776b9b11bf708 OP_EQUAL
address
32cnYruRguQbrj3v1VT4nxkdQFcmc2E71B
transaction
ec607b5bd668f98fd47981c84cfa9f954e67f9825d752a2e5fd4f7c82b053296
confirmations
217559
spent
true